Originally Posted by jpc:

first, hopefully i am in the correct forum

 

lionel was the only product available when i was a kid, but i see an o gauge distributer called mth (less expensive)...do people mix and match - for example if i were to buy a transformer from meh, would it work on lionel products or do you risk losing some of the bells and whistles (literally) - is the rolling stock compatible

 

...am i better served buying through the internet or working through a dealer

 

1.  Yes, you are on the correct forum.  Welcome!

 

2.  Yes, you most definitely can "mix and match" MTH, Lionel and other products (Williams by Bachmann, Weaver, Atlas, RMT, etc.).  With a conventional transformer (as compared to digital command control) virtually all items--locomotives, rolling stock, accessories and the related basic features such as smoke, whistle, bell, etc.--are interchangeable between manufacturers.  Things get a bit more complicated when digital command control is considered (Lionel TMCC/Legacy and MTH DCS), but at this point that's not something for you to be terribly concerned about.  In fact, I would suggest you not get involved with either digital command system until you become a bit more familiar with what is available out there in the broader O gauge hobby in terms of brands, track systems, road names you may prefer, and so forth.  Do NOT allow yourself to be overwhelmed by the choices--there are tons of choices out there--and do not leap into one thing or another until you have taken a good look around for yourself.

 

You are almost always better served by working with a local dealer, if at all possible.  If that is not a possibility, try to find a reliable online dealer that you can establish a relationship with.  There are many good ones around, and the one you pick should be one that normally stocks the lines and items that most interest you.  At least that is a good place to start.
